The Honest Space
A virtual peer support group for parents pre-pregnancy and beyond. This is a space to share, connect, and feel truly seen. Whether you are navigating fertility, sleepless nights, identity shifts, or just need a place to talk, we are here for you.
Starting in September and facilitated by Stephanie Kolaski (Internal Nesting Wellness) and Amanda Gurman (Honest As A Mother).

Flora's Walk Team Hamilton
Team Hamilton is back for it's 5th year support the national Flora's Walk for Perinatal Mental Health! We are a group of clinicians, support workers, advocates, and parents all working together to increase awareness and access to accessible and affordable perinatal care for our community!
Date: Sunday, May 3, 2026 from 10am-1pm (stop by at anytime)
Location: Optimist Club of Stoney Creek.
There will be speakers, raffle prizes, and family activities!
